Output 59ab8a2223bdee2bfe1a8a2a1d24a61695581362701550c66d1d744a198ed719:0

value
50963163554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e76c9dec78707e9c4d7e694be4c486be1b6a9c59 OP_EQUALVERIFY OP_CHECKSIG
address
DSEkkQSrYexCEWs92HJHd1vR3ZMMsUZQSP
transaction
59ab8a2223bdee2bfe1a8a2a1d24a61695581362701550c66d1d744a198ed719